The philosophical anti-utopia of Ray Bradbury paints a hopeless picture of the development of a post-industrial society. A novel that brought world fame to its creator.
Sensational was Bradbury's claim in 2007 that Fahrenheit 451 was misunderstood. This book is not about government censorship, this is a story about how television destroys the interest in reading books. In the early 1950s, most Americans did not see television, but Bradbury predicted a new era of freedom, prosperity and entertainment, when the desire to be happy, multiplied by political correctness, would lead to a ban on books.
